Skin cancer is a major public health issue in New Zealand

 

 


Together we can reduce the incidence and impact of skin cancer in New Zealand  


MelNet brings together health professionals, health promoters, researchers, policy makers and advocates to improve how we prevent, detect and treat skin cancer. 

By working together, we can reduce inequities, improve outcomes and save lives now and into the future.
